Growth protocol The plants were grown in the green house for nine days and were used for RNA extraction afterwards
Extracted molecule total RNA
Extraction protocol Total RNA was isolated with TriReagent (Sigma-Aldrich) and purified with RNeasy Mini Kit (Qiagen) according to the manufacture's protocol. The quality of the total RNA was evaluated with Bioanalyzer 2100 (Agilent Technologies) based on RNA integrity number (RIN). All samples had the RIN greater than 8.
Label Cy3
Label protocol Cy-3 labeled microarray probes (cRNA-Cy3) were synthesized from 200 ng of total RNA using one-color Low Input Quick Amp Labeling Kit, according to Agilent manufacturer’s protocol. The quality of synthesized cRNAs was checked with Nanodrop ND-1000 spectrophotometer (NanoDrop Technologies) considering a minimal yield of 1.65 μg and a specific activity of more than 6 pmol/μl Cy3/μg cRNA.
 
Hybridization protocol The probes were hybridized on Agilent maize custom arrays 4X180k. Hybridization was carried out for 17 hours at 65°C, followed by washing. In addition, to avoid the ozone effects on Cy-3 signal, a supplementary organic solvent containing an ozone scavenging compound dissolved in acetonitrile was used after washing step.
Scan protocol The slides were scanned on Agilent Microarray Scanner (G2565CA) at 2 µm
Data processing The scanned images were analyzed with Feature Extraction Software v.11 (Agilent) using default parameters (protocol GE1_1105_Oct12 and Grid: 062494_D_F_20131129) to obtain median signal intensities. Data processing were done in R.Control features as well as saturated and non-uniformed features were removed. Data were normalized using quantile method.
